Transaction ea80a1984aaa1c1a26a2660f8f7e4f552c759186997cf94ae64d3de4e3cdf96f

4 Input
2 Outputs
  • ea80a1984aaa1c1a26a2660f8f7e4f552c759186997cf94ae64d3de4e3cdf96f:0
  • value  21591591
    address  bc1qkj0hw0wp4g4ldyzxknnhkjmxwsujzrt24whq20
  • ea80a1984aaa1c1a26a2660f8f7e4f552c759186997cf94ae64d3de4e3cdf96f:1
  • value  20064358
    address  34MCv1zdwdfSNnGyxZLd1Rqgvvm4hP93uz